KCC forms committee to investigate fuel theft

Khulna City Corporation (KCC) has formed a fresh three-member committee to investigate an alleged fuel theft incident involving one of its vehicles.

According to an office order signed by KCC Acting Secretary Rahima Khatun Bushra on May 4, the committee has been asked to submit its report within five working days. The committee is headed by KCC Executive Engineer (Mechanical) Md. Anisuzzaman. Its other members are Conservancy Officer Mohammad Anisur Rahman and Sub-Assistant Engineer (Mechanical) Mohammad Selimul Azad, reports BSS.

The office order said that on March 19, two days before Eid, Khalishpur B-Region Supervisor Nuruzzaman Sumon informed KCC Administrator Nazrul Islam Manju over mobile phone that fuel was allegedly being stolen from the fuel tank of a backhoe loader in the Khalishpur New Market area.

Following the administrator’s instruction, officials rushed to the spot and seized a container containing several litres of fuel. The driver of the vehicle, Enayet Hossain Babul, was immediately barred from operating the loader.

Sources said this is the third committee formed over the incident. Earlier, a committee was reconstituted after objections were raised regarding one of its members.
